Key Considerations Before Investing in Recessed Lighting
Before diving into any purchase, it’s vital to understand what makes a good recessed lighting solution and whether it’s the right fit for your needs. Recessed lighting, by its nature, offers a clean, uncluttered look that traditional fixtures simply can’t match. It effectively solves the problem of ceiling clutter, distributing light evenly without drawing attention to the light source itself, perfect for modern minimalist interiors or enhancing architectural features.
The ideal customer for recessed lighting is someone seeking a sleek, contemporary aesthetic, improved energy efficiency, and versatile illumination for various rooms, from the living room to the bathroom. Those undertaking renovations, or simply looking to upgrade their existing lighting, will find this category particularly appealing. However, if your preference leans towards highly decorative, statement lighting pieces like chandeliers or ornate pendants, or if you need extremely focused task lighting in very specific spots without general ambient light, recessed downlights might not be your primary solution – track lighting or dedicated task lamps could be more suitable.
Before committing to a purchase, several factors demand careful thought. Consider the **IP rating**; for bathrooms, kitchens, or outdoor covered areas, an IP65 rating is crucial for water and dust resistance. **Colour temperature** is another critical aspect – do you prefer warm white (2700K) for a cosy ambiance, natural white (4000K) for functional clarity, or cool white (6000K) for bright, task-oriented spaces? The **installation depth** is vital, especially for shallow ceiling voids, as an ultra-slim design can simplify the process significantly. Lastly, evaluate the **lumen output** for brightness, **energy efficiency** for running costs, and confirm **dimmability** if you desire adjustable light levels, which, as we’ll discuss, can be a point of confusion for some products.

Important Considerations: Non-Dimmable Nature & No Fire Rating
It’s crucial to address two points that might cause confusion or require specific attention for potential buyers. Firstly, despite the “Dimmable” designation in the product name, my experience and numerous other user reviews strongly indicate that these particular Leselux LED Recessed Ceiling Lights are *not* dimmable. This is a significant point of clarification; if you require dimming functionality, you would need a different model or an external dimmer compatible with non-dimmable LEDs, which can be complex and may not yield satisfactory results. This discrepancy in the product description versus actual functionality should be clearly noted.
Secondly, these downlights are explicitly stated as “No Fire Rated.” In the UK, building regulations often stipulate that downlights installed into ceilings, particularly between floors or near loft spaces, must be fire-rated to maintain the fire integrity of the building structure. While the IP65 rating is excellent for moisture protection, the absence of a fire rating means these lights might not be suitable for all installation scenarios, particularly where fire safety compliance is a legal requirement. Always check local building codes and consult with a qualified electrician to ensure these downlights are appropriate for your specific installation location. While this isn’t a flaw in the product itself, it’s a critical consideration that differentiates it from higher-cost, fire-rated alternatives.
